MAKE AND BREAK AT SPICY MEXPIPE

Posted July 14, 2017
Puerto Escondido continues to pump. Over the course of July 8-10, a solid south swell rifled into Playa Zicatela, with some of the world’s elite big wave surfers on tap as Mexpipe served up prime beef.
Your cast here, Fransico Porcella, Greg Long, Coco Nogales, Eric de Souza, Alex Gray, Jojo Roper and more.

As lensman, Edwin Morales recalls: “July 8th was one of the best first days of the swell we have seen in a long time. It was around six foot at first light and in two hours, the swell had filled in very quickly reaching 12ft. The next day was solid 15-18ft and pristine conditions. It has been a special run of swell cause pretty much every surfer out was getting barrelled.
“Of course there was carnage, Jamie Mitchell got a pretty bad injury and so did a few other guys. Messed up knees, backs, necks and a high number of broken boards. Lucky everyone is ok. Low tide in the mornings made it really thick. Looks like more swell on the way.”
